A community CCTV system in Arklow has been turned on for testing.
Partly funded by the local municipal district, the Arklow Town Team also received approval for the maximum grant of €40,000 towards the installation of the system from the Department of Justice.
The 11 cameras are strategically placed around the town at locations between Upper Main Street to Lower Main Street, River Walk and the North Quay.
An official launch will be held at a later date when current Covid 19 restrictions are lifted.
